  1. 1. Autophagy and senescence in primary human bronchial epithelial cells in the context of COPD

    University essay from Lunds universitet/Examensarbeten i molekylärbiologi

    Author : Annie Vegraeus; [2023]
    Keywords : Biology and Life Sciences;

    Abstract :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) is the third largest cause of death worldwide, with its most prominent risk factor being inhalation of smoke and pollutants. In this project, we studied two processes that are involved in COPD: autophagy and cellular senescence. READ MORE

  2. 2. Uncertainties in the use of synthetic CT (sCT) for daily online adaptive radiotherapy for lung cancer

    University essay from Lunds universitet/Sjukhusfysikerutbildningen

    Author : Johansson Vivika; [2023]
    Keywords : Medicine and Health Sciences;

    Abstract : Background and purpose: Cone Beam Computed Tomography (CBCT) based online adaptive radiotherapy (oART) has been clinically implemented for several anatomical sites worldwide. However, random and abrupt anatomical changes with large density alterations can occur in lung patients, leading to uncertainties with synthetic computed tomography (sCT) and dose calculation.   4. 4. Marginal bone loss around dentalimplants: comparison between smokers and non-smokers. : A retrospective clinical study

    University essay from Malmö universitet/Odontologiska fakulteten (OD)

    Author : Amir Ali; Ammar Al-Attar; [2022]
    Keywords : ;

    Abstract : Purpose The aim of the present retrospective study was to compare the marginal bone loss (MBL)around dental implants in a group of smokers in relation to a matched group of non-smokers. Materials and methods The present dental record-based retrospective study included patients selected fromindividuals treated with dental implants during the period 1980-2018 at one specialist clinicin Malmö.
